About this event

Enjoy a friendly and informal journey through Old World and New World wines, hosted in the historic surroundings of Selwyn college and accompanied by a delicious 3-course lunch. Starting with Champagne, we'll taste 13 wines from all around the world comparing them with wines made in France using the same grape. No previous tasting experience is needed. We will focus on grapes such as Cabernet Sauvignon, Syrah/Shiraz, Pinot Noir, Sauvignon Blanc, Chardonnay and others. We'll try French versions against versions from Chile, Argentina, Australia, New Zealand, USA or South Africa. For added fun we'll do some of the comparisons blind to see if I can teach you how to spot the difference through smell and taste alone. Over lunch we’ll also explore the principles of food and wine pairing, tasting several wines with the dishes to see if we prefer French or New World with food. After lunch, enjoy the spectacle of opening Champagne with a sabre, followed by a short tour of Selwyn College and a glimpse into its history. The afternoon then continues with more comparisons, stories and insights, finishing at around 4pm. All diets can be catered for at lunch.
